Background

About White_Pointer Gaming

White_Pointer Gaming is a creator with a presence on YouTube (27,000 followers), based in Australia. Their content sits in the retro gaming space. Their YouTube bio reads: "How's it going everyone? I'm an Australian gamer who started playing games on the Intellivision. Hailing from the land of fauna that wants to kill you, what better creature to name myself after than a shark? On this channel I try to focus o". The full audience and engagement breakdown is below.

Frequently Asked Questions

Why is the channel called White Pointer Gaming?

White Pointer Gaming takes its name from the white pointer shark, which is the common Australian term for the great white shark. The creator chose it as a nod to their Australian identity, joking in their bio that they come from a land famous for wildlife that wants to kill you — so naming themselves after one of the country's most notorious predators felt fitting.

What console did White Pointer Gaming start gaming on?

White Pointer Gaming started playing video games on the Intellivision, one of the earliest home gaming consoles released in the late 1970s. That unusually deep history with old hardware informs the channel's focus on retro console education and video game history going back to the very beginning of home gaming.

What is the 'graphical tricks in classic games' series on White Pointer Gaming?

The graphical tricks in classic games series is one of White Pointer Gaming's signature formats, where the channel deep-dives into the clever programming techniques developers used to push old hardware beyond its apparent limits. The recurring 'Your questions answered' episodes in the series mean the creator actively incorporates viewer submissions, turning it into an ongoing community-driven conversation.

Does White Pointer Gaming answer viewer questions on the channel?

Yes — the 'Your questions answered' episodes are a recurring part of the channel, particularly within the graphical tricks series. This format lets viewers submit follow-up questions from earlier videos, and the creator works through them in dedicated episodes, giving the channel a back-and-forth educational feel rather than just one-off standalone videos.

Did White Pointer Gaming make a video about the Nintendo 64's technical limitations?

Yes, White Pointer Gaming published a video titled 'The weird technical restrictions of the Nintendo 64', examining the unusual engineering constraints of that console and how they affected games. It fits the channel's broader pattern of explaining not just what old hardware could do, but why it worked the way it did under the hood.

What does White Pointer Gaming's Super Nintendo background modes video explain?

The video titled 'What did all of the Super Nintendo's background modes actually do?' breaks down the SNES graphics hardware's layering system and how each background mode was designed to be used by developers. It's the kind of technical deep-dive the channel is built around — making console architecture accessible to people who love retro games but aren't hardware engineers.

Is White Pointer Gaming good for learning about how old consoles actually worked?

White Pointer Gaming is one of the more educational voices in the retro gaming space, focusing specifically on how classic hardware and games functioned technically rather than just reviewing or playing them. The channel covers video game history, console architecture, graphical tricks, and retrospectives — all aimed at explaining the 'why' behind the games people grew up with.

Is White Pointer Gaming from Australia?

Yes, White Pointer Gaming is an Australian creator, and they lean into that identity openly in their channel branding and bio. Despite being based in Australia, the channel's audience is primarily based in the United States and the United Kingdom, which is typical for English-language retro gaming education content.

What kind of retro gaming videos does White Pointer Gaming make?

White Pointer Gaming focuses on educational retro gaming content — including deep dives into how classic consoles were engineered, graphical tricks developers used on limited hardware, video game history, and in-depth retrospectives. The style is analytical rather than let's-play, aimed at viewers who want to understand the technical and historical context behind games from the 8-bit and 16-bit eras and beyond.
